CNC lathe programming is the specialized discipline of creating the instruction set that controls the operation of CNC lathes and turning centers for the production of rotationally symmetric parts. This process involves generating G-code and M-code that command the machine's movements, spindle speeds, and auxiliary functions. While it shares foundational principles with milling programming, it operates within a distinct kinematic environment where the workpiece rotates and tools primarily move in the X (radial) and Z (axial) axes. Programming can be done manually for simple parts or, more commonly, using CAM software that automatically generates efficient toolpaths from a 2D drawing or 3D model. The programmer must strategically sequence operations, typically starting with facing and rough turning cycles (often using canned cycles like G71) to remove the bulk of material, followed by finish turning (G70) to achieve the final dimensions and surface finish. Grooving, threading (G76), and drilling cycles are also fundamental. The complexity escalates significantly with modern multi-axis turn-mill centers. For these machines, the programmer must seamlessly integrate commands for live tooling (M-codes to activate milling spindles on the turret) and the C-axis (for precise angular positioning of the workpiece). This enables off-center milling, drilling, and tapping, allowing for the complete machining of complex parts in a single "done-in-one" setup. Key considerations include proper application of tool nose radius compensation (G41, G42) to ensure dimensional accuracy, selecting optimal insert geometries and grades for the material, and programming chip-breaking cycles to manage long, stringy chips. Effective CNC lathe programming is a blend of software skill, practical machining knowledge, and strategic planning, directly impacting production efficiency, tool life, and the geometric and dimensional precision of the final turned component.
